Transaction ae50332466376fd15b77509905aebe39106d96b176869cefe038d7a5593a73dc

2 Input
2 Outputs
  • ae50332466376fd15b77509905aebe39106d96b176869cefe038d7a5593a73dc:0
  • value  158800
    address  3Dnri3befoxU1kFTvsT6jck9nRpGxySGPh
  • ae50332466376fd15b77509905aebe39106d96b176869cefe038d7a5593a73dc:1
  • value  1050275
    address  35D1s74UA3156HxKeGUaqLPUCtQLhhXqfQ